Knowing the several Levels of Anxiety
Anxiety is just not a a person-dimensions-matches-all situation. It exists with a spectrum, ranging from moderate occasional stress to critical, debilitating indicators that will completely disrupt your lifetime.
Moderate Stress usually will involve occasional stress about particular predicaments like occupation interviews, social gatherings, or essential selections. You would possibly encounter some Bodily symptoms like butterflies with your belly or non permanent problems sleeping, but these emotions Will not noticeably interfere together with your everyday pursuits or associations.
Moderate Nervousness turns into far more persistent and begins affecting various parts of your lifetime. You could find yourself avoiding certain cases, experiencing normal physical indications like complications or muscle mass stress, or getting issue concentrating at get the job done or residence. Slumber complications develop into a lot more Recurrent, and you could possibly discover improvements within your hunger or Strength concentrations.
Extreme Stress and anxiety may be frustrating and life-altering. This level typically features worry assaults, constant be concerned that feels extremely hard to regulate, major avoidance of normal activities, and physical signs and symptoms that might include fast heartbeat, shortness of breath, or feeling such as you're shedding Management. Significant stress regularly occurs together with other mental overall health problems like depression, having Conditions, or substance use issues.

What Can make Masters-Amount Clinicians Distinct
Masters-stage clinicians, such as Certified Scientific Social Workers (LCSWs) and Licensed Qualified Counselors (LPCs), complete about two years of graduate training centered totally on simple counseling abilities and standard therapeutic procedures. Their training normally covers basic methods to stress remedy and provides a strong Basis for dealing with uncomplicated panic displays.
Even so, masters-degree plans have considerable limitations With regards to preparing clinicians for complex stress and anxiety scenarios. The coursework focuses greatly on Understanding certain methods as opposed to understanding the deeper psychological theories that specify why And the way these procedures get the job done. Because of this when conventional ways You should not operate, or when anxiety occurs along with other sophisticated mental medical issues, masters-amount clinicians may well not possess the educational foundation to adapt their treatment method solution successfully.
Moreover, masters systems typically need only 600-1000 several hours of supervised scientific experience, which offers simple competency but restricted exposure to the entire range of anxiety shows and treatment difficulties you may encounter.
The Doctoral-Amount Variance: Why Education and learning and Education Make a difference
Doctoral-amount medical psychologists complete six a long time of intensive graduate education and learning, accompanied by a complete calendar year of supervised internship teaching, after which an additional 12 months of write-up-doctoral supervised medical practical experience ahead of they could become licensed. This in depth eight-calendar year teaching method presents numerous critical benefits when dealing with elaborate anxiousness:
Detailed Theoretical Basis: Doctoral courses need in-depth examine of psychological theories, exploration approaches, and the science behind human behavior and psychological health and fitness. This means your psychologist understands not exactly what techniques to make use of, but why they get the job done and how to modify them when normal methods aren't effective.
Advanced Evaluation Capabilities: Doctoral-degree psychologists acquire considerable teaching in psychological testing and evaluation. This implies they can correctly recognize when your panic may very well be difficult by other disorders like consideration issues, Mastering disabilities, or character things that may impression your therapy.
Investigation and Critical Considering: Doctoral schooling emphasizes investigate abilities and demanding contemplating, enabling psychologists to remain latest with the most up-to-date proof-dependent treatments and adapt their approach according to new scientific findings. They are properly trained To judge the performance of different treatment options and make informed conclusions about what's going to operate ideal more info to your particular scenario.
Extensive Medical Instruction: The doctoral internship year as well as the essential publish-doctoral calendar year give two complete decades of intensive, supervised experience with advanced instances across various settings. What this means is your psychologist has most likely encountered and correctly handled panic shows similar to yours, even when they're intricate or unusual. The submit-doctoral yr is particularly precious as it allows new psychologists to give attention to producing specialized techniques though nonetheless obtaining skilled supervision.
